Responsibilities of a Surveying Company Near Me Research
Before performing the survey, a surveyor will conduct extensive research on the property. They will review previous surveys, land deeds, and other legal documentation depending on the type of survey needed This research educates the surveyor on all previous and existing property features and allows them to determine how the property’s artificial and natural structures have changed.
Follow Technical Standards
All surveyors must know and adhere to state technical standards to ensure the survey provides accurate and specific information. Oklahoma surveying standards include accurately recording existing boundaries if any inconsistencies arise, displaying accurate surveyor information with an official seal and signature, providing details regarding specific abbreviations and symbols used, and more Additional standards and regulations must be followed if certified in CFedS surveying Tulsa Oklahoma.

Documentation
Once the survey has been completed, surveyors are responsible for documenting and compiling the data into an accurate survey map. Depending on the client’s requests and type of project, many details are required in a survey map and other legal documentation For example, the survey map must include the following and more:
● Official road names and address numbers
● The location and elevation of natural features on the property.
● Contour lines that show varying elevations throughout the property
● The locations of sidewalks, roads, and entrance drives
● The location of permanent artificial structures, such as buildings and bridges
